The amount of calcium given is also going to depend on how often the animal eats prey items with bones in them. Pinkies should always be dipped in calcium when given, as they have weak bone structure and are low in calcium.
The Pacman food does not need to be given with supplements because they are already in them.
I'm assuming you would give calcium three times a week to a baby frog. Once they get over two inches they arent going to need to eat but every two or three days, adults, even less.
